They work by gently lifting the sides of the nose outward, reducing airflow resistance without any active pharmaceutical ingredient. This makes them a straightforward option for anyone whose sleep, exercise, or general comfort is affected by nasal congestion or narrowing — whether from a deviated septum, seasonal rhinitis, or the mild swelling that tends to worsen at night.
They are commonly used by people who snore due to nasal obstruction, by athletes who want to reduce the effort of breathing during training, and by those who simply wake up with a dry mouth from mouth-breathing. They are not a treatment for sleep apnoea or chronic nasal disease, but as an adjunct — or a first step — they are worth trying before more involved interventions.
Because there is no drug absorbed and no systemic effect, they carry a low risk profile and are suitable for most adults, including during pregnancy when many decongestant medications are best avoided. Fit matters: the strip should sit flat across the nose for the lift to work properly. Skin sensitivity is the main thing to watch — if irritation develops, discontinue use.

Apply one strip to the outside of the nose at bedtime or before exercise, following the placement guide on the packaging. Clean and dry the skin first for the adhesive to hold correctly. Remove gently; do not reuse a strip.
For most people, yes. There is no drug absorbed and no dependency risk. The main consideration is skin sensitivity from the adhesive — if redness or irritation develops with regular use, take a break and check whether a gentler skin preparation helps.
They may reduce snoring that is caused specifically by nasal obstruction or narrowing, by improving airflow through the nose. They are not effective for snoring that originates in the throat or soft palate, and they are not a treatment for obstructive sleep apnoea.
Nasal strips are generally considered suitable during pregnancy because they have no pharmacological effect. They are often suggested as an alternative when nasal decongestant sprays or antihistamines are best avoided. Check with your midwife or GP if you have any concerns.
Yes — reducing nasal airflow resistance during training is one of the most common uses. They are worn externally and do not affect breathing mechanics beyond widening the nasal valve, so they are straightforward to use during most forms of exercise.
The skin needs to be clean, dry, and free of moisturiser or oil before application. Place the strip across the widest part of the nose and press firmly along its length. Sweating can reduce adhesion, so for exercise use, patting the area dry immediately before applying helps.
